Output 304d6cdc78d1f13bce833163511099b9fc205d9d6029997f892808e1ac80027a:0

value
2792052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17e26058c60a824c0bb7e951cb4c401b336d972f OP_EQUALVERIFY OP_CHECKSIG
address
13BHjKPG5Q7SWCdMep3QcewTnnTRzEjqtB
transaction
304d6cdc78d1f13bce833163511099b9fc205d9d6029997f892808e1ac80027a
spent
true